What Frustrating Issues Do Plants Face Without Flow Control Valves?

When a manufacturer runs a high pressure hydraulic system without premium calibrated flow controlling equipment there will be consistent maintenance issues and money lost on the factory floor. Below are some of the most common issues that exist when factories use sub-standard regulating devices:

  • Unchecked Cylinder Slamming : When hydraulic oil is pumped to an actuator without a properly-adjusted throttling valve, hydraulic oil will be pumped at the maximum speed of the pump into the actuator. This results in the mechanical piston hitting the end stop of the actuator with an excessive amount of force causing structural members and adjacent components to break.
  • Severe Hydraulic Drift : Valves manufactured with lower quality standards have loose tolerances internally. When subjected to continuous system heat, oil sweeps past the unpolished internal needle, causing heavy machine arms or lifting presses to sag and drift mid-shift.
  • Rapid Oil Overheating : Inadequately machined internal flow paths produce high levels of friction, which greatly increase fluid shear. This rapidly raises the temperature of your hydraulic oil, destroying system seals, degrading the oil quality, and forcing you to change your oil frequently.
